java冒泡排序代码 java中的冒泡排序?
java中的冒泡排序?public void bubbleSort(int[] data,String sortType) {if (sortType.equals(冒泡排序最多计算公式?#包

java中的冒泡排序?
public void bubbleSort(int[] data,String sortType) {
if (sortType.equals(
冒泡排序最多计算公式?
#包括
void main()
{
int a[10]
int i,j,t
printf(
冒泡排序的关键字段?
1.原理简介
相邻数据两两比较,小的在前,大的在后。总共要比较n-1次,排序一次,确定最大值的位置。
2.代码实现
int arr[]={3,9,4,7,1,10,2,6,5,8}
//外部循环控制时间
for (int i=0 i lt arr.length - 1 i ) {
//内部循环是比较元素大小。
for (int j=0 j lt arr.length - 1 - i j ) {
//比较两个相邻的元素
if (arr[j] gt arr[j 1]) {
//位置交换
int tmp=arr[j]
数组[j]=数组[j 1]
arr[j 1]=tmp
}
}
}
for (int i=0 i lt arr.length i ) {
(排列[i] #34 #34)
}